import type { APIRequestContext, Locator, Page } from '@playwright/test';
|
||||
import { expect } from '@playwright/test';
|
||||
|
||||
import { authToken } from './dashboards';
|
||||
|
||||
// Helpers for the V2 dashboard detail page (`DashboardPageV2`), which now serves
|
||||
// /dashboard/:id unconditionally. The V1 helpers in ./dashboards.ts still cover
|
||||
// seeding through the v1 API and the list page.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// Interaction contracts encoded here rather than in each spec:
|
||||
// - a multi-select variable commits on dropdown CLOSE, not per toggle;
|
||||
// - an ALL selection renders as an overlay reading "ALL", not as tags;
|
||||
// - a variable is only settled once its options have arrived.
|
||||
|
||||
export const dashboardV2Path = (id: string): string => `/dashboard/${id}`;
|
||||
|
||||
/** Perses-style spec the v2 API stores. Only what the specs need is typed. */
|
||||
export interface DashboardV2Spec {
|
||||
display: { name: string; description?: string };
|
||||
layouts: unknown[];
|
||||
panels: Record<string, unknown>;
|
||||
variables: unknown[];
|
||||
[key: string]: unknown;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
export const SCHEMA_VERSION = 'v6';
|
||||
|
||||
/** An empty but valid spec — the base every fixture spreads over. */
|
||||
export function emptyV2Spec(name: string): DashboardV2Spec {
|
||||
return { display: { name }, layouts: [], panels: {}, variables: [] };
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// ─── Seeding through the v2 API ───────────────────────────────────────────
|
||||
//
|
||||
// Specs seed the shape they assert against, rather than relying on whatever the
|
||||
// v1 -> v2 migration happens to produce or on telemetry that ambient data may or
|
||||
// may not contain. Migration output is covered on its own, from the v1 fixtures.
|
||||
|
||||
export async function createDashboardV2ViaApi(
|
||||
page: Page,
|
||||
name: string,
|
||||
spec?: Partial<DashboardV2Spec>,
|
||||
): Promise<string> {
|
||||
const token = await authToken(page);
|
||||
const res = await page.request.post('/api/v2/dashboards', {
|
||||
data: {
|
||||
name,
|
||||
schemaVersion: SCHEMA_VERSION,
|
||||
tags: [],
|
||||
// `name` wins over any display name the fixture carries, so a fixture can be
|
||||
// seeded twice under two titles and each spec can still find its own.
|
||||
spec: {
|
||||
...emptyV2Spec(name),
|
||||
...spec,
|
||||
display: { ...spec?.display, name },
|
||||
},
|
||||
},
|
||||
headers: { Authorization: `Bearer ${token}` },
|
||||
});
|
||||
if (!res.ok()) {
|
||||
throw new Error(
|
||||
`POST /api/v2/dashboards ${res.status()}: ${await res.text()}`,
|
||||
);
|
||||
}
|
||||
const body = (await res.json()) as { data?: { id?: string } };
|
||||
const id = body.data?.id;
|
||||
if (!id) {
|
||||
throw new Error(
|
||||
`POST /api/v2/dashboards returned no id: ${JSON.stringify(body)}`,
|
||||
);
|
||||
}
|
||||
return id;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
export async function getDashboardV2(
|
||||
page: Page,
|
||||
id: string,
|
||||
): Promise<{ spec: DashboardV2Spec; [key: string]: unknown }> {
|
||||
const token = await authToken(page);
|
||||
const res = await page.request.get(`/api/v2/dashboards/${id}`, {
|
||||
headers: { Authorization: `Bearer ${token}` },
|
||||
});
|
||||
if (!res.ok()) {
|
||||
throw new Error(
|
||||
`GET /api/v2/dashboards/${id} ${res.status()}: ${await res.text()}`,
|
||||
);
|
||||
}
|
||||
const body = (await res.json()) as {
|
||||
data: { spec: DashboardV2Spec; [key: string]: unknown };
|
||||
};
|
||||
return body.data;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
export async function deleteDashboardV2ViaApi(
|
||||
request: APIRequestContext,
|
||||
id: string,
|
||||
token: string,
|
||||
): Promise<void> {
|
||||
await request.delete(`/api/v2/dashboards/${id}`, {
|
||||
headers: { Authorization: `Bearer ${token}` },
|
||||
});
|
||||
}

// ─── Variables bar ────────────────────────────────────────────────────────
|
||||
|
||||
export const variablesBar = (page: Page): Locator =>
|
||||
page.getByTestId('dashboard-variables-bar');
|
||||
|
||||
/** The pill for one variable: its name, the control, and (while loading) a spinner. */
|
||||
export const variablePill = (page: Page, name: string): Locator =>
|
||||
page.getByTestId(`variable-${name}`);
|
||||
|
||||
/** List variables (query / custom / dynamic) — the select control. */
|
||||
export const variableControl = (page: Page, name: string): Locator =>
|
||||
page.getByTestId(`variable-select-${name}`);
|
||||
|
||||
/** Text variables — a plain input, not a select. */
|
||||
export const variableTextInput = (page: Page, name: string): Locator =>
|
||||
page.getByTestId(`variable-input-${name}`);
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* The bar collapses variables that do not fit into a "+N" button. At the config's
|
||||
* 1280px viewport that starts with the second variable, so a spec asserting on
|
||||
* several pills at once must widen the viewport:
|
||||
*
|
||||
* test.use({ viewport: WIDE_VIEWPORT });
|
||||
*/
|
||||
export const WIDE_VIEWPORT = { width: 1920, height: 1080 };
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* The overflow ("+N") tooltip listing the collapsed variables. `.first()` because the
|
||||
* tooltip primitive renders its content twice — once visible, once as an a11y copy —
|
||||
* so an unscoped locator is a strict-mode violation rather than a missing element.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
export const hiddenVariablesTooltip = (page: Page): Locator =>
|
||||
page.getByTestId('hidden-variables-tooltip').first();
|
||||
|
||||
/** Resolved when the variable's options have arrived and its spinner is gone. */
|
||||
export async function awaitVariableSettled(
|
||||
page: Page,
|
||||
name: string,
|
||||
): Promise<void> {
|
||||
await expect(variablePill(page, name)).toBeVisible();
|
||||
await expect(page.getByTestId(`variable-loading-${name}`)).toBeHidden();
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* What a list variable's closed control shows — "ALL" for an ALL selection, else its
|
||||
* tags. Asserts the control exists first: a missing one (wrong name, or a text
|
||||
* variable, which uses {@link variableTextInput}) otherwise hangs until the test
|
||||
* times out with nothing to point at.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
export async function readVariableSelection(
|
||||
page: Page,
|
||||
name: string,
|
||||
): Promise<string> {
|
||||
const pill = variablePill(page, name);
|
||||
await expect(pill).toBeVisible();
|
||||
// The ALL overlay sits in the control's wrapper, as a SIBLING of the element
|
||||
// carrying the testid — scope from the pill, or an ALL selection reads as empty.
|
||||
const allOverlay = pill.locator('.all-text');
|
||||
if ((await allOverlay.count()) > 0 && (await allOverlay.isVisible())) {
|
||||
return (await allOverlay.textContent())?.trim() ?? '';
|
||||
}
|
||||
return (await variableControl(page, name).innerText()).trim();
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/** The open option list, whichever control opened it. */
|
||||
export const anyDropdown = (page: Page): Locator =>
|
||||
page.locator('.custom-multiselect-dropdown, .custom-select-dropdown');
|
||||
|
||||
export async function openVariableDropdown(
|
||||
page: Page,
|
||||
name: string,
|
||||
): Promise<void> {
|
||||
await awaitVariableSettled(page, name);
|
||||
await variableControl(page, name).click();
|
||||
await expect(anyDropdown(page)).toBeVisible();
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* Close the open dropdown, which is what commits a multi-select edit. Pressing
|
||||
* Escape leaves the control focused without re-opening it, unlike clicking away.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
export async function closeVariableDropdown(page: Page): Promise<void> {
|
||||
// Escape closes it when the control still holds focus, which a row click can move.
|
||||
// Falling back to a click outside covers that, and is what a user does anyway —
|
||||
// either way the close is what commits the edit.
|
||||
await page.keyboard.press('Escape');
|
||||
if (await anyDropdown(page).first().isVisible()) {
|
||||
await page.getByTestId('dashboard-title').click();
|
||||
}
|
||||
await expect(anyDropdown(page).first()).toBeHidden();
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
const escapeForRegExp = (value: string): string =>
|
||||
value.replace(/[.*+?^${}()|[\]\\]/g, '\\$&');
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* One option row in the open dropdown, matched on its label element rather than the
|
||||
* row's accessible name: hovering reveals the Only / Toggle buttons, whose text joins
|
||||
* that name, so a name-based locator stops matching halfway through an interaction.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
export function optionRow(page: Page, value: string): Locator {
|
||||
const exact = new RegExp(`^${escapeForRegExp(value)}$`);
|
||||
// Multi-select rows carry a `.option-label-text` and, once hovered, Only / Toggle
|
||||
// buttons whose text would break an exact match on the row itself. Single-select
|
||||
// rows have neither — just the label — so each shape needs its own matcher.
|
||||
const multi = page
|
||||
.locator('.custom-multiselect-dropdown .option-item')
|
||||
.filter({ has: page.locator('.option-label-text', { hasText: exact }) });
|
||||
const single = page
|
||||
.locator('.custom-select-dropdown .option-item')
|
||||
.filter({ hasText: exact });
|
||||
return multi.or(single);
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
export async function pickVariableValues(
|
||||
page: Page,
|
||||
name: string,
|
||||
values: string[],
|
||||
): Promise<void> {
|
||||
await openVariableDropdown(page, name);
|
||||
const [first, ...rest] = values;
|
||||
|
||||
// Start from the row's "Only" button rather than its checkbox: an ALL selection
|
||||
// opens with every option checked, so a click would UNcheck the wanted value and
|
||||
// leave the rest selected. "Only" collapses to exactly this option either way,
|
||||
// and the clear icon is deliberately unavailable while the draft is all.
|
||||
// Wait for each target to be visible before acting: the dropdown re-renders as
|
||||
// options resolve, and a click on a row that is still arriving (or has just been
|
||||
// replaced) hangs until the test times out.
|
||||
const firstRow = optionRow(page, first);
|
||||
await expect(firstRow).toBeVisible();
|
||||
await firstRow.hover();
|
||||
const onlyButton = firstRow.locator('.only-btn');
|
||||
await expect(onlyButton).toBeVisible();
|
||||
await onlyButton.click();
|
||||
|
||||
// Additional values then add to that selection. Click the row's checkbox, not the
|
||||
// row: the row body carries no toggle handler, so clicking it leaves the option
|
||||
// unchecked and the value silently absent from the commit.
|
||||
for (const value of rest) {
|
||||
const row = optionRow(page, value);
|
||||
await expect(row).toBeVisible();
|
||||
const checkbox = row.locator('.option-checkbox');
|
||||
if ((await checkbox.count()) > 0) {
|
||||
await checkbox.first().click();
|
||||
} else {
|
||||
await row.click();
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
await closeVariableDropdown(page);
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/** Type a value the option list does not offer, and commit it. */
|
||||
export async function typeVariableValue(
|
||||
page: Page,
|
||||
name: string,
|
||||
value: string,
|
||||
): Promise<void> {
|
||||
await openVariableDropdown(page, name);
|
||||
await page.keyboard.type(value);
|
||||
const dropdown = page.locator('.custom-multiselect-dropdown');
|
||||
await dropdown.getByText(value, { exact: true }).first().click();
|
||||
await closeVariableDropdown(page);
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// ─── Panels and sections ──────────────────────────────────────────────────
|
||||
|
||||
export const panelByTitle = (page: Page, title: string): Locator =>
|
||||
page.locator('[data-panel-id]').filter({ hasText: title });
|
||||
|
||||
export const sectionByName = (page: Page, name: string): Locator =>
|
||||
page.locator('[data-section-id]').filter({ hasText: name });
|
||||
|
||||
/** Resolved when no panel on the page is still fetching. */
|
||||
export async function awaitPanelsSettled(page: Page): Promise<void> {
|
||||
await expect(page.getByTestId('panel-refetching')).toHaveCount(0);
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* The values currently checked in a multi-select's list, read from the open dropdown —
|
||||
* the closed control shows at most one tag plus a "+N", so it cannot confirm a
|
||||
* multi-value selection on its own. Excludes the aggregate ALL row.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
export async function readCheckedOptions(
|
||||
page: Page,
|
||||
name: string,
|
||||
): Promise<string[]> {
|
||||
await openVariableDropdown(page, name);
|
||||
const labels = await page
|
||||
.locator(
|
||||
'.custom-multiselect-dropdown .option-item[aria-selected="true"]:not(.all-option) .option-label-text',
|
||||
)
|
||||
.allInnerTexts();
|
||||
await closeVariableDropdown(page);
|
||||
return labels.map((label) => label.trim());
|
||||
}

@@ -0,0 +1,91 @@
|
||||
// Keeps the suite honest: a spec is either running and complete, or parked in
|
||||
// parked-specs.json with a reason. Fails on a skipped/fixme'd/only test in a spec that
|
||||
// is not parked, and on a parked entry that no longer matches anything.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// Run: pnpm guard:specs
|
||||
|
||||
import { readdirSync, readFileSync, statSync } from 'node:fs';
|
||||
import { dirname, join, relative, resolve } from 'node:path';
|
||||
import { fileURLToPath } from 'node:url';
|
||||
|
||||
const root = resolve(dirname(fileURLToPath(import.meta.url)), '..');
|
||||
const parked = JSON.parse(
|
||||
readFileSync(join(root, 'parked-specs.json'), 'utf8'),
|
||||
);
|
||||
|
||||
/** Every *.spec.ts under tests/, repo-relative with forward slashes. */
|
||||
function specFiles(dir) {
|
||||
return readdirSync(dir, { withFileTypes: true }).flatMap((entry) => {
|
||||
const full = join(dir, entry.name);
|
||||
if (entry.isDirectory()) {
|
||||
return specFiles(full);
|
||||
}
|
||||
return entry.name.endsWith('.spec.ts') ? [full] : [];
|
||||
});
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/** A parked glob (`**/tests/x/y.spec.ts`) matched against an absolute path. */
|
||||
function matchesGlob(glob, absolutePath) {
|
||||
const ANY_DIRS = '\u0000';
|
||||
const pattern = glob
|
||||
.replace(/[.+^${}()|[\]\\]/g, '\\$&')
|
||||
.replace(/\*\*\//g, ANY_DIRS)
|
||||
// Single `*` never crosses a path separator; do this before expanding ANY_DIRS,
|
||||
// whose replacement itself contains a `*`.
|
||||
.replace(/\*/g, '[^/]*')
|
||||
.split(ANY_DIRS)
|
||||
.join('(?:.*/)?');
|
||||
return new RegExp(`^${pattern}$`).test(absolutePath.split('\\').join('/'));
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// Declaration form only — `test.skip(condition, reason)` inside a test body is a
|
||||
// legitimate runtime guard, not a parked test.
|
||||
const OFFENDERS = [
|
||||
{ label: 'test.skip', re: /(?<![\w.])test\.skip\(\s*['"`]/g },
|
||||
{ label: 'test.fixme', re: /(?<![\w.])test\.fixme\(\s*['"`]/g },
|
||||
{ label: 'describe.skip', re: /describe\.skip\(/g },
|
||||
{ label: 'describe.fixme', re: /describe\.fixme\(/g },
|
||||
{ label: 'test.only', re: /(?<![\w.])test\.only\(/g },
|
||||
{ label: 'describe.only', re: /describe\.only\(/g },
|
||||
];
|
||||
|
||||
const testsDir = join(root, 'tests');
|
||||
const files = statSync(testsDir, { throwIfNoEntry: false })
|
||||
? specFiles(testsDir)
|
||||
: [];
|
||||
const failures = [];
|
||||
|
||||
for (const file of files) {
|
||||
if (parked.specs.some((glob) => matchesGlob(glob, file))) {
|
||||
continue;
|
||||
}
|
||||
const source = readFileSync(file, 'utf8');
|
||||
for (const { label, re } of OFFENDERS) {
|
||||
const hits = source.match(re);
|
||||
if (hits) {
|
||||
failures.push(
|
||||
`${relative(root, file)}: ${hits.length} × ${label} — finish it, or park the spec in parked-specs.json with a reason`,
|
||||
);
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
for (const glob of parked.specs) {
|
||||
if (!files.some((file) => matchesGlob(glob, file))) {
|
||||
failures.push(
|
||||
`parked-specs.json: "${glob}" matches no spec — drop the stale entry`,
|
||||
);
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
if (failures.length > 0) {
|
||||
console.error(
|
||||
`\nguard:specs failed\n\n${failures.map((f) => ` ✗ ${f}`).join('\n')}\n`,
|
||||
);
|
||||
process.exit(1);
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// eslint-disable-next-line no-console
|
||||
console.log(
|
||||
`guard:specs ok — ${files.length - parked.specs.length}/${files.length} specs running, ${parked.specs.length} parked`,
|
||||
);
